    Commercial - Operations Liaison Manager

    Job Description

    • Job Summary: The Commercial - Operations Liaison is a critical role within our organization, serving as the vital link between our clients and operational teams. The primary responsibility of this role is to ensure the effective setup of our products, guarantee delivery accuracy and timing, and facilitate a seamless onboarding experience for new clients. This position requires strong communication and organizational skills to manage client needs and operational execution effectively.

    Key Responsibilities:

    • Act as the primary point of contact between clients and operational teams, ensuring clear communication and alignment on project requirements and timelines.
    • Oversee the initial onboarding phase for new clients, ensuring they are familiarized with our products and services through comprehensive training sessions.
    • Collaborate closely with clients to understand their specific needs and objectives, translating these into actionable plans for the operational team.
    • Coordinate with the operations team to ensure accurate and timely delivery of products and services, addressing any issues that may arise promptly.
    • Monitor the setup process to ensure that all client requirements are met and that any potential challenges are identified and resolved quickly.
    • Provide ongoing support to clients during the initial phase, ensuring they have a positive experience and are fully satisfied with our solutions.
    • Develop and maintain strong relationships with clients, acting as a trusted advisor and point of contact for any future needs or inquiries.
    • Continuously seek opportunities to improve the onboarding and delivery processes, implementing best practices to enhance client satisfaction and operational efficiency.
    • Prepare and deliver regular reports to senior management on client onboarding progress, delivery status, and any issues encountered.
    • Thought leadership: Work with key individuals within the sales team in order to decide on Thought Leadership topics, and provide the business with content to build relationships with clients, with a main focus on C-Suite engagement.

    Qualifications:

    • Bachelor's degree in Business, Operations Management, Data Science, or a related field.
    • Proven experience in a client-facing role, preferably within a data research or analytics company.
    • Strong project management skills with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and meet deadlines.
    •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build strong relationships with clients and internal teams.
    • Detail-oriented with a focus on ensuring accuracy and quality in all deliverables.
    • Ability to work independently and as part of a team, demonstrating flexibility and adaptability.
    • Proficiency in using project management tools and software to track and report on progress.
    • A proactive and problem-solving mindset, with the ability to identify potential issues and develop effective solutions.

    Senior Research Manager

    Job Description

    • Accountable for a team of Researchers determined either by area or product or sector or client
    • Supervises all stages of project management and monitors performance
    • Responsible for the training and development of team and peers
    • Provides advice and consultation to clients and staff
    • Handles complicated client queries or complaints
    • Ensure projects are profitable via efficient, timeous delivery of projects
    • Designs and plans research projects following client commissioning and needs
    • Design questionnaires,samples and methodologies of collecting information
    • Co-operates the execution of projects, informs clients on progress and gives specific instructions to other departments regarding the collection and electronic processing of information
    • Presents results of study to the clients
    • Some travelling required
    • The following responsibilities apply to all “People Managers” Senior Manager Only:
    • Mentors/coaches direct reports (provides insight/advice and ensures each has substantive development plans in place)
    • Ensures that all down line positions and critical retains have appropriate back-up contingency plans (minimum of 1 ready now candidate for all critical positions)
    • Effectively appraises and rewards performance

    II. Key Skills/Competencies:
    A.
    Key Functional Skills/Competencies

    • University degree in Marketing, Economics or related field
    • Minimum 8 years experience in Marketing Research
    • Strong analytical mind
    • Very good knowledge on advanced analysis, methods, and tools
    • Excellent numerical skills
    • Good organisational skills, and strong people management skills
    • Very good interpersonal skills
    • Strong business acumen and financial knowledge
    •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
    • Fluency in English
    • Computer Literate
    • Expertise in servicing customers and in-depth knowledge on CR methods, analysis and techniques
    • Good knowledge of the characteristics of the relevant markets
